A MakerBot Case Study
State University of New York faced the challenge of giving a diverse student body and regional manufacturers access to cutting‑edge fabrication technology to boost creativity, hands‑on learning, and workforce development. To address this need, they partnered with MakerBot to bring desktop 3D printing into campus programs and community outreach using MakerBot Replicator 3D Printers.
MakerBot installed the world’s first MakerBot Innovation Center at SUNY New Paltz, equipping the Hudson Valley Advanced Manufacturing Center with more than 30 MakerBot Replicator printers as part of a $1.5M initiative (supported by a $250,000 donation and matching grant). The MakerBot solution sharply reduced prototyping cost and time (a lamp housing went from $75 to $0.50 and two hours to produce), created a cross‑disciplinary hub, enabled courses and community programs, and began offering 3D printing services to local businesses—improving student career readiness and regional economic impact.
